Leadership Review Briefing — Inventory Write-Down

Branch managers should note that Halvorn Trading will record a write-down on slow-moving Kestrel-line stock held at the Marwick depot. The adjustment reflects ageing inventory and softer seasonal demand, not process failure. Branch-level reporting stays unchanged; central finance will post the entry this quarter. Further context on how this shapes next year's stocking strategy follows below.

board note of yajef-baduf: Gross margin on Holix came in at 10 percent against a plan of 15 percent. Only 3 of the 120 pilot accounts renewed Holix, so a churn review is set for April 1.

## Health checks — Quillgate LB

Targets behind the Quillgate balancer must pass two consecutive checks before receiving traffic. Failing targets drain for 30s before removal. Do not point checks at /; use the dedicated probe route, which skips auth. If flapping occurs, widen the interval before touching thresholds. Current probe settings are listed below.

service settings:
WENATH_PIN=5007
WENATH_METRICS_HOST=metrics.wenath.tolvaqlabs.corp
WENATH_LOG_LEVEL=debug
WENATH_TENANT=rusox

**TKT-4471: ThumbVault image cache leaking memory + creds expired**

The Pixbin cache node has been leaking ~200MB/hr and restarts stopped pulling fresh assets because the service creds expired mid-incident. Restart loop is masked for now. To get the cache warm again, re-auth the fetcher against the internal asset API with the replacement key below.

app token of bahaf-tajeg = zpat23_SjjsllwiLmXbtS65veZaV47